Frequently Asked Questions about Aurora
How much are Studio apartments in Aurora?
There are currently 319 Studio Apartments in Aurora with rent ranges from $750 to $2,251 with an average price of $1,396.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Aurora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Aurora ranges from $788 to $5,627 with an average monthly rent of $1,603.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Aurora c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Aurora range from $910 to $6,361.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,029.
How expensive are Aurora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 280 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Aurora on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$750 to $7,392 - averaging $2,797 for the location.
